# These control page layout and rasterization for customer invoices.
# Release note for the manager: changing any of these shifts line-item
# wrapping, which can push totals onto a second page and break the
# archived-PDF diff checks in the release pipeline. Treat them as part
# of the public contract with finance at Hollow Pine HQ. If a release
# requires a change, bump the template version and regenerate fixtures.
# The current values, verified against the v9 templates, are listed below.

constants for bawif-kawif:
QUOTAS = {
    "ulaael": 5,
    "holael": 10,
}

Subject: Quickstore 4.2 — bloom filter now fronts the KV layer

Plugin authors: starting with this release, Quickstore places a bloom filter ahead of the key-value store. Negative lookups return faster; false positives fall through safely. No API changes are required on your side. Verify your plugin against the staging build referenced below.

session token of fahif-tadup = htk3_9c7

Hey Marit — quick handover before your shift at the Tollgate Row desk. Visitors sign in on the tablet, get a red lanyard, and wait on the sofas until their host collects them. Don't let anyone through the barriers unescorted, even if they say they know the way — Dalva from Procurement will vouch, people try it weekly. Couriers go to the loading bay side door, not the lobby. If you need to buzz someone through yourself, use the pass code below.

door code, yagap-bahof: bdg-O-05

**Vendor note: Inkmill markdown pipeline**

Rendering for Parchway docs is outsourced to Inkmill under an annual contract, renewing each March. They handle sanitization and PDF export; we own the upload queue. SLA: 4-hour response on rendering failures. Escalate only after two failed retries. Their support desk is reachable at the address below.

billing contact of hahaf-baguf = zorael.tammir.jorius@sivrelhq.internal

## Soft deletes in the orders table

Welcome to the Marnwell data team! Quick heads-up: we never hard-delete rows in `orders`. Instead we set `deleted_at` and keep everything around for audits and the occasional "oops, undo that" request. Filters in OrdyQuery handle this automatically, so don't write raw deletes. If you ever need to purge for real (rare!), you'll need approval plus access to the retention vault, which opens with the passphrase below.

vault phrase of yawig-bawig = fenael-norael-eliox-gilox-casath-druath-zorys-istwyn-jorwyn